Asthma flare-ups can cause the lower esophageal sphincter to relax, allowing stomach contents to flow back, or reflux, into the esophagus some asthma medications (especially theophylline) may worsen reflux symptoms on the other hand, acid reflux can make asthma symptoms worse by irritating the airways and lungs. Generally speaking, reflux may cause asthma symptoms in two ways. 1) the stomach acid that leaks back into the esophagus creates a chain reaction leading to asthma symptoms. the refluxed gastric acid irritates the nerve endings in the esophagus generating signals to the brain.. You experience asthma symptoms after eating foods that make reflux worse, such as a high-fat meal, alcohol, chocolate, or caffeine. you are taking medications known to increase acid reflux, such as calcium channel blockers (e.g. nifedipine for hypertension), prescription pain medications (e.g. lortab), or osteoporosis treatments (e.g. fosamax)..
